If a window is cloudy glass, it may be due to the seal within the glass breaking down. This could cause moisture to be introduced into the room, which can be a problem for homeowners who live in the area. Some companies will claim that this problem can be resolved by drilling a hole in the glass and sucking out the moisture, but this isn't effective, and it can harm the frame of the window.

Wood windows made of old-growth hardwoods can last for a lifetime if they are properly maintained and properly restored. National Park Service Preservation Brief 9 Repair of Historic Timber Windows recommends replacing only the part that has become damaged, such as a sill or muntin, rather than the whole window. Restoration experts can preserve the appearance of an historical building, while avoiding unnecessary replacements.
